How to Install and Uninstall libalut0 Package on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us)

Last updated: September 20,2024

1. Install "libalut0" package

Here is a brief guide to show you how to install libalut0 on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install libalut0

2. Uninstall "libalut0" package

This tutorial shows how to uninstall libalut0 on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us):

$ sudo apt remove libalut0 $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ove

Description-en: OpenAL Utility Toolkit
freealut is a free implementation of OpenAL's ALUT standard. ALUT is a set of
portable functions which remove the annoying details of getting an audio
application started. It is the OpenAL counterpart of what GLUT is for OpenGL.
